Electrolux Dishwashing
Undercounter Dishwashers WT30E
The Electrolux Dishwashing range is produced for customers with the highest conceivable demands for good
efficiency,
economy and ergonomics for dishwashing operation. The product range comprises of glasswashers,
undercounter
dishwashers, hood type dishwashers, rack type dishwashers, flight type dishwashers and pot and pan washers.
The undercounter dishwasher WT30E specified on this sheet has been specifically designed to meet UK water
supply authority requirements for direct connection to a water supply and has a capacity of 30 baskets per
hour.
EASY TO INSTALL AND MAINTAIN
• The WT30E is supplied to
operate from a single phase 6,85
kW electrical supply but can be
modified on installation to operate
from a three phase supply or even
a 13A single phase connection.
• Integral class 'A' air break for
direct connection to mains water
supply.
• Equipped with drain pump to
facilitate installation to drains
above floor level
• Efficient non-return valve in
water inlet circuit.
• Required only the same space
as a conventional domestic
dishwasher.
• Simple service from the front.
EASY TO CLEAN
• WT30E has smooth surfaces and
a fully pressed wash tank with
rounded corners to facilitate
cleaning.
• Wash/rinse arms and nozzles in
stainless steel.
• Wash/rinse arms and filter easy
to remove.
• No pipes inside the washing
chamber.
• Self cleaning cycle, easy to
activate.
• The external panels are in AISI
304 stainless steel for easier
cleaning and hygienic reasons.

EASY TO USE
• Simple control panel, with digital
window for wash and rinse
temperature.
• Three dishwashing programs,
one for lightly soiled tableware,
one for normally soiled items and
a third program for heavy soiled
items.
• Alternative model, WT38 MED,
provides a thermal disinfection
thanks to the 30 sec. rinsing cycle
at 85°C.
• Built-in rinse aid and detergent
peristaltic pumps for a perfect
rinsing result.
• Times and temperatures can be
changed on each cycle for wash
and rinse.
• Pre-arrangement for HACCP
system implementation and
Energy Management device.
